Pavillion dm4-2120ew
Microsoft Windows 10 (64-bit)

Hello,

 

Will HP Pavillion dm4-2120ew work with Intel Centrino Advanced-N 6230.  If not, which dual band/Bluetooth radio will.  Please list part numbers of all cards which fit criteria.

 

Thank You.

HP Recommended

Hello, thank you for the prompt response.  None of the options listed support 5Ghz.  WIll the Intel Centrino Advanced-N 6230 (HP P/N 636672-001) definitely not work?  If not, why?  Thank you.

HP Recommended

Hello pkrzesinski,

 

Thank you for your reply.

 

After lot of research,

I found that this Part number 636672-001doesnt show the dm4-2120ew model under the compatible List and might not be supported by your systemboard and BIOS. I guess.

 

However I checked this : 572511-001

http://www.intel.com/content/www/us/en/processors/centrino/centrino-ultimate-n-6300-brief.html

 

This is tested for your model and also supports 2.4Ghz and 5.0 GHz.

http://www.ebay.com/itm/Intel-Centrino-Ultimate-N-6300-572511-001-HP-8440P-2540P-WiFi-Adapter-WLAN-C...

Hello, I'd like to provide an update.  I ordered the Centrino Ultimate-N 6300 (Model: 633ANHMW/PN: 572511-001), it arrived today.  It worked on the first try with the 5GHz signal (white antenna wire to TR1, black to TR2).  I'm getting 53Mbps vs. 28Mbps with the old card.  Thank you!
